The Healthcare Gamification market in 2025 is experiencing rapid growth driven by the convergence of gaming principles, behavioral psychology, and technology innovation to drive patient engagement, education, and behavior change in healthcare settings. Gamification refers to the integration of game mechanics, such as rewards, challenges, progress tracking, and social interactions, into non-game contexts, including patient education, therapy adherence, wellness programs, and medical training. With factors such as the rise of chronic diseases, medication non-adherence, and lifestyle-related health challenges, healthcare providers, payers, and digital health companies are leveraging gamification solutions to motivate patients, improve treatment outcomes, and foster long-term behavior change. Gamified applications, wearable devices, virtual reality simulations, and interactive digital platforms offer immersive and engaging experiences, empowering individuals to take control of their health, learn new skills, and adopt healthier habits in a fun and interactive manner. Moreover, with advancements in AI-driven personalization, data analytics, and remote monitoring capabilities, gamification solutions are becoming increasingly personalized, adaptive, and scalable, driving innovation and differentiation in the healthcare market. As the industry continues to embrace patient-centered care models and population health management approaches, the healthcare gamification market is poised for continued growth, offering innovative solutions to address the complex challenges of health behavior change and patient engagement in an increasingly digital and connected world.

The exercise game segment is projected to be the largest in the healthcare gamification market in 2025, fueled by the growing emphasis on fitness, chronic disease management, and preventive healthcare. Exercise games, also known as exergames, combine physical activity with interactive digital experiences, making them highly popular for promoting an active lifestyle. The increasing prevalence of obesity, cardiovascular diseases, and sedentary lifestyles has led to greater adoption of gamified fitness solutions across all age groups. Additionally, the integration of wearable fitness trackers and smart devices with exercise gaming platforms has enhanced user engagement and personalized workout experiences. The expansion of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R)-based fitness applications, along with the rising trend of home-based workouts, has further propelled this segment’s growth. Corporate wellness programs and healthcare providers are also incorporating gamified exercise solutions to encourage physical activity and improve patient outcomes. With continued advancements in motion-sensing technology, AI-driven fitness coaching, and immersive gaming experiences, the exercise game segment is expected to generate the highest revenue in the healthcare gamification market.
The therapeutics segment is anticipated to be the fastest-growing in the healthcare gamification market over the forecast period from 2025 to 2034, driven by the increasing use of game-based interventions for mental health, physical rehabilitation, and chronic disease management. Gamified therapeutic solutions, including digital therapeutics (DTx), virtual reality (VR)-assisted rehabilitation, and cognitive training games, are gaining traction for their ability to enhance patient engagement and treatment adherence. The rise in mental health disorders, neurological conditions, and musculoskeletal issues has fueled demand for interactive, game-based therapy programs that offer personalized and adaptive treatment experiences. Moreover, advancements in AI-driven gamification, biofeedback mechanisms, and mobile-based therapeutic applications are further driving market expansion. With growing support from healthcare providers, regulatory approvals for digital therapeutics, and increasing investments in health-tech startups, the therapeutics segment is expected to achieve the highest compound annual growth rate (CAGR) in the healthcare gamification market during the forecast period.
The US Healthcare Gamification Market size is estimated at $1734 Million in 2025. The healthcare gamification market in the United States is driven by the rising adoption of digital health solutions, increased focus on patient engagement, and the integration of gaming elements into fitness and chronic disease management platforms. With a growing emphasis on preventive healthcare, mobile health (mHealth) apps, wearables, and telehealth platforms are incorporating gamified features such as rewards, leaderboards, and challenges to encourage healthy behaviors. Insurance companies and corporate wellness programs are also leveraging gamification to incentivize healthier lifestyles among employees and policyholders. Additionally, the high penetration of smartphones and AI-driven personalized health tracking tools further supports market growth. However, regulatory concerns regarding patient data security, the challenge of sustaining user engagement, and the need for clinically validated outcomes pose challenges for long-term adoption.
Europe Healthcare Gamification Market continues to offer significant business potential with $1377 Million sales revenue in 2025. In Europe, the healthcare gamification market is shaped by strong government support for digital health, stringent data privacy regulations under GDPR, and growing awareness of mental and physical well-being. Countries like Germany, the UK, and the Netherlands are at the forefront of integrating gamification into health and wellness apps, with a particular focus on chronic disease management, rehabilitation, and mental health therapy. The region’s aging population is also driving demand for gamified cognitive training tools designed for dementia prevention and elderly care. However, challenges such as regulatory barriers for digital therapeutics, concerns about digital addiction, and the need for multilingual, culturally adapted gamification solutions impact market expansion. Despite this, increasing investments in AI-driven gamification and VR-based therapeutic interventions are expected to drive future growth.
South East Asia is among the fastest growing regions worldwide for Healthcare Gamification Market. Over the forecast period to 2034, South East Asia Healthcare Gamification Market demand is poised to register a robust growth rate of 17.2%. The healthcare gamification market in Southeast Asia is expanding due to rising smartphone penetration, increasing digital health adoption, and growing awareness of lifestyle diseases. Countries like Singapore, Malaysia, and Indonesia are witnessing significant traction in fitness-tracking apps, step-count challenges, and gamified chronic disease management programs, particularly for diabetes and cardiovascular conditions. The region’s young, tech-savvy population is highly receptive to gamification-driven wellness programs, and corporate wellness initiatives are increasingly integrating gamified incentives to promote employee health. However, the market faces hurdles such as lower healthcare infrastructure digitization in certain countries, affordability concerns for premium digital health solutions, and limited regulation around gamification-based healthcare interventions. Nonetheless, partnerships between digital health startups and healthcare providers are expected to drive deeper market penetration.
Saudi Arabia’s healthcare gamification market is growing as part of the country’s broader push toward digital transformation and preventive healthcare under Vision 2030. The government's focus on improving public health and reducing lifestyle-related diseases, such as obesity and diabetes, has led to increased adoption of digital wellness platforms with gamified elements. The rising popularity of fitness apps, weight loss challenges, and rewards-based wellness programs in workplaces and insurance plans is further fueling demand. However, cultural preferences, regulatory frameworks for digital health, and the need for Arabic-language gamification content pose barriers to widespread adoption. Despite these challenges, increasing investment in AI-powered health gamification tools, VR-based medical training simulations, and partnerships with global digital health firms are likely to support long-term growth in the market.
